About McCormick & Company, Incorporated

In its 130-year history, McCormick has grown to become the leading global manufacturer, marketer, and distributor of spices, herbs, extracts, seasonings, and other flavorings. Beyond end consumers, McCormick's customer base also includes top quick-service restaurants, retail grocery chains, and other packaged food and beverage manufacturers, with about 30% of sales generated beyond its home turf to include 150 other countries and territories. In addition to its namesake brand, the firm's portfolio includes Old Bay, Zatarain's, Thai Kitchen, Frank's RedHot, French's, and the recently acquired Cholula brand.

About Nuwellis Inc

Nuwellis, Inc. is a medical device company focused on developing and commercializing fluid management solutions. The company's primary product is an ultrafiltration system used in hospitals to remove excess fluid from patients with fluid overload, often associated with conditions such as heart and kidney failure. Nuwellis aims to improve patient outcomes and reduce healthcare costs through its specialized, innovative therapies.
